Photo1_4I’m sure you’ve heard about the old adage, “ different strokes for different folks.” In trade show and event exhibiting, it also works that way. A number of exhibitors find display ownership beneficial for them while others are the noncommittal type—they opt to rent exhibits rather than purchase them.

Given the expected life span of a trade show display is three to five years and that a lot can happen or change during this time, perhaps it does make sense to rent. Photo2

In fact, industry observers are saying that exhibit rental is fast becoming an alternative to owning and maintaining a display. Why? Flexibility and Price.

Today, exhibit rental provides any exhibitor the flexibility of having a customized presentation without having to commit to, or invest in, a specific format too soon. This flexibility accommodates testing displays and trying out shows without incurring steep costs.

Photo3_2Another advantage of renting a display is the convenience of not worrying about long term storage, maintenance, or inventory management costs. The exhibit rental company shoulders all these costs.

With all these positive points about exhibit rental, I wouldn’t be surprised if more exhibitors will seriously consider it. But then again, it’s still hard to discount exhibit ownership since it definitely has its own merits. Now, that would be an entirely different topic for a future blog.
